Design Clutch Wear Monitoring to Provide the Right Time to Change the Clutch and Prevent Unscheduled Breakdown on Heavy Duty Trucks

Abstract

Heavy-duty trucks are a long-term investment capital in the field of heavy equipment. There are still many trucks that experience breakdowns. The most common damage is clutch damage. This research using experimental methods to designs a clutch wear monitoring tool that can send real-time notifications (using the internet of things). This device uses an ultrasonic sensor to detect clutch wear and combines it with the SIM800L GSM Module as a data sender. Vehicle owners or foreman mechanics can monitor via the Blynk application. This notification is in the form of a clutch condition still in a clutch normal, clutch warning and clutch limit.
